ABSTRACT:
A contact terminal includes an electrically conductive plate including a base plate; an electrical contact section, engageable with another terminal, formed at a front end portion of the base plate; a wire clamping section, for clamping a wire thereto, formed at a rear end portion of the base plate; an electrically conductive section formed between the electrical contact section and the wire clamping section, the electrically conductive section including first and second side walls and a bottom wall which is a part of the base plate and is formed between the first and second side walls, the first and second side walls which have first and second blades extending inwardly to confront each other so as to define a slot therebetween; and a step portion formed in the base plate between the electrical contact section and the wire clamping section so that a section of the base plate in the step portion in the front-to-rear direction is non-linear.
